Added install deps step to circle yaml
This commit is contained in:
parent
8d273d6a1e
commit
6d4df426a9
3 changed files with 9 additions and 0 deletions
6
Makefile
6
Makefile
|
|
@ -57,3 +57,9 @@ bench:
|
|||
test: $(PKGS)
|
||||
$(PKGS): golang-test-all-deps
|
||||
$(call golang-test-all,$@)
|
||||
|
||||
$(GOPATH)/bin/glide:
|
||||
@go get github.com/Masterminds/glide
|
||||
|
||||
install_deps: $(GOPATH)/bin/glide
|
||||
@$(GOPATH)/bin/glide install
|
||||
|
|
|
|||
|
|
@ -9,6 +9,7 @@ checkout:
|
|||
- $HOME/ci-scripts/circleci/golang-move-project
|
||||
compile:
|
||||
override:
|
||||
- make install_deps
|
||||
- make build
|
||||
test:
|
||||
override:
|
||||
|
|
|
|||
|
|
@ -18,3 +18,5 @@ testImport:
|
|||
- package: github.com/stretchr/testify
|
||||
subpackages:
|
||||
- assert
|
||||
- package: gopkg.in/Clever/kayvee-go.v6
|
||||
version: ^6.0.0
|
||||
|
|
|
|||
Loading…
Reference in a new issue